Welcome to the Belt and Road Deal-Making session! Our dynamic platform provides 1-to-1 match-making meetings, Summit participants will be able to meet with potential business partners based on their shared areas of interest through pre-arranged meetings. An online platform will also be opened to deal-making participants to manage individual schedules and make additional meeting requests.

Whether you're an investor seeking lucrative opportunities, a project owner looking to secure funding, or a service provider ready to showcase your offerings - we cater to your needs. 

Exclusively for Belt and Road Summit participants

Exclusive deal-making sessions are available to Belt and Road Summit participants, including investors, project owners, and service providers. If interested, please first register for the Belt and Road Summit 2025. 

Remember to use the same email address for both your summit registration and access to the deal-making platform to facilitate account verification and ensure seamless participation.
